In this captivating conversation with Real Estate Entrepreneur and fellow podcast host Tanya Rooney, we explore how building a strong tribe around yourself can transform not only your business but your entire approach to life. Oh and we just may have started a revolution (opt in now) in a way of thinking about your next step towards the life of you dreams:) Tanya shares her remarkable journey from corporate project manager to successful real estate investor, revealing the pivotal moment when a frustrating work situation on a Saturday prompted her to make a life-changing decision. Her transition into flipping houses and eventually building a thriving short-term rental business wasn't just about changing careers—it was about designing a life aligned with her values and surrounded by people who elevate her.What sets Tanya apart is her extraordinary commitment to personal accountability. She's maintained a daily "miracle morning" practice for over 2,600 consecutive days and regularly takes on year-long challenges like running a mile every day or writing daily thank-you notes. These habits haven't just improved her discipline; they've fundamentally shifted how she approaches limitations and excuses.The heart of our conversation centers on Tanya's philosophy of intentional community building. As the host of the Tribe Builders podcast, she emphasizes that success—in business and life—comes from surrounding yourself with people who understand your journey, provide honest feedback, and share your frequency. Whether it's creating mastermind groups or smaller "coffee clubs," Tanya demonstrates that the energy exchange between like-minded individuals creates an environment where everyone thrives.We also dive into practical advice for finding your people, managing your energy, and living life fully in the present rather than waiting for "someday." Tanya's approach to adventure and connection will inspire you to evaluate your own circles and perhaps make some changes to elevate your life experience.Ready to build your tribe and design a life that excites you?
